Today we decided to ‘think outside the crate-box’ and we created a chalkboard frame with the wood slats instead.
Here are the steps to create this fun card:
1. Create a card base with your white card stock.
2. Cut black cardstock to 3 3/4” x 4 3/4”.
3. Stamp and die cut the 3 flowers and leaves in your favorite colors.
4. Die cut 2 pallets, and stamp on 4 of the slats with your woodgrain stamps.
5. Trim off 4 of the slats, clipping the little connectors in-between the slats off. Leave two at full size for the sides of the frame. Cut 1” off two of the slats for the top and bottom of the frame.
6. Use your embossing powder tool on the black cardstock before embossing. Rather than wipe away the chalk residue, we left it on to give it more of a used chalkboard feel. Build your sentiment of choice (there are many to mix & match), stamp with white pigment ink, sprinkle with white embossing powder and heat set.
7. Adhere the black card stock to the front of the card base.
8. Adhere the side frames with tape adhesive. Attach the top and bottom frame pieces, and the flowers/leaves by using some foam tape to give it a little dimension.
It was pretty quick & easy to create!
